Job Title: Systems Analyst 3
Location: Austin, TX
Job Summary:


  • Client requires the services of 2 Systems Analyst 3, hereafter referred to as Candidate(s), who meet the general qualifications of Systems Analyst 3, Applications/Software Development and the specifications outlined in this document for the Client.
  • Understands business objectives and problems, identifies alternative solutions, performs studies and cost/benefit analysis of alternatives.
  • Analyzes user requirements, procedures, and problems to automate processing or to improve existing computer system: Confers with personnel of organizational units involved to analyze current operational procedures, identify problems, and learn specific input and output requirements, such as forms of data input, how data is to be summarized, and formats for reports.
  • Writes detailed description of user needs, program functions, and steps required to develop or modify computer program. Reviews computer system capabilities, specifications, and scheduling limitations to determine if requested program or program change is possible within existing system.
  • The Java EE Developer are expected to contribute to the design, development, and deployment of enterprise-grade applications using Java EE technologies, while aligning with HHSC's goals of modularity, security, and interoperability.


  • Analyze legacy Java EE components, including EJB, JPA, and SOAP services, to support architectural decision-making.
  • Participate in application rationalization and transformation planning.
  • Support technical walkthroughs and documentation activities to map current application behavior, dependencies, and integration points.
  • Collaborate with architects and business analysts to help ensure modernization efforts retain core business logic and interoperability.
  • Assist in migrating legacy systems to cloud-native platforms, emphasizing microservices and API-driven architectures.
  • Utilize AI code analysis tools for examining legacy Java EE applications.
  • Extract and document detailed business requirements and rules based on existing code.
  • Work with business stakeholders and technical teams to validate and adjust identified requirements.
  • Identify and record technical debt, design patterns, and architectural details within legacy systems.
